CBD Brand Director Sentenced for Covid Loan Fraud and Money Laundering
The director of UK CBD brand Virtutum Limited, which traded as CBD Asylum in Hull, has been given a suspended prison sentence for fraud and money laundering. Alex Hope, 41, and his co-director Liam Jones, 42, both pleaded guilty to fraud at Hull Crown Court in June 2026.
